World War Z is a post-apocalyptic zombie movie starring Brad Pitt.

The film is based on Max Brooks' 2006 novel World War Z: An Oral History Of The Zombie War, which is set in Philadelphia in the aftermath of a war between humans and zombies.

Some filming for the Paramount Pictures movie has already taken place in Valletta in Malta and in Falmouth in Cornwall.

It is due to be released next year. :zombie:
